Silene vulgaris subsp. megalosperma is a herbaceous perennial belonging to the Caryophyllaceae family. Indigenous to Europe, this subspecies is primarily associated with temperate conditions. It is a naturally occurring subspecies of Silene vulgaris, which is linked below, along with related subspecies and varieties of this species.
